Job summary
A seafood processing company in Juneau, Alaska, is seeking a Maintenance Technician responsible for repairing mechanical devices including hydraulics and small engines. Ideal candidates will have at least two years of mechanical experience, a valid driver's license, and the ability to meet safety standards. This position requires physical strength and the flexibility to work varying hours, including overtime during the summer. Competence in basic English and mathematical skills is essential.
